Quasi-static elastography is a widely applied ultrasound method in which RF data acquired in tissue at different states of deformation are correlated to estimate displacements and strain (displacement gradient). A world-band triple-mode SOC compliant with 802.11a/b/g is realized in 0.13 mum CMOS technology.
